What is the ratio of 11 inches to 3 feet? (Change the feet to inches.) Group of answer choices

11:36
36:11
3:11
11:3​

Answer:

The first option (11:36)

Step-by-step explanation:

When you convert the 3 feet to inches, you multiply by 12. There is 12 inches in each foot, so multiply 3 by 12 will result in 36.

We are comparing the 11 inches to the 3 feet (36 inches), so it would look like this:

11 : 36

(Can also be shown as 11 - 36)
